Boron Removal from Aqueous Solution by Bipolar Electrodialysis

摘要

Boron removal process using electrodialysis method combined with bipolar membrane water splitting reaction was investigated. By using bipolar membrane electrodialysis, pH value of boron contained solution will immediately increase and the dissociation reaction of boric acid into borate ions was enhanced. Therefore, boron can be effectively removed from boron contained solution. Experimental results confirm that bipolar membrane electrodialysis has an advantage over existing electrodialysis. Effect of initial concentration was investigated. It was confirmed that energy requirement for boron removal increase when the initial boron concentration increase.
